Excalibur
Excalibur was sculpted by Sarah Minkiewicz-Breunig and introduced in earthenware china in 2000. He is a small 1:12 scale, or in plastic model horse terminology, Classic scale. Excalibur represents a light draft stallion and is the first of many of Sarah's sculptures that Joanie would produce in ceramic. Joanie finished a run of 20 lilac roan Excaliburs, as well as two customs, a bay and a dapple grey; Sarah finished seventeen artist choice customs, all in different colors. Lesli Kathman also finished a couple. (The bay in the top row might be Joanie's, but Joanie is unsure.) All together 38 Excaliburs were made. Click on the pictures below for larger views.
